hey guy starting on my project of re timing a motor the PO couldnt get timed ( 95 gst )

i striped the timing belt off and am starting from the basics ( the car was sitting for over a year and a half ) --

my question is should the oil pump be really hard to turn? i was under the impression that it should spin pretty freely and not be hard enough to turn that i have to put a ratchet on it and put some good force behind it to spin it

do i have a problem here or is this normal?

thanks in advance
 
I recently retimed my buddys 96 gst and for sure i remember that it didnt take much to spin the oil pump to align the timing marks.. only the crank took some force of course. If i were you id do the good old fashion water pump, oil pump, tensioner, and of course oem belt replacement. Especially since its been sitting for that long, you dont want to just slap things back together and risk head problems. Better to be safe than sorry especially with dsm's
 
ok sounds like that things toast, i timed the motor and its all timed correctly, im getting

45,0,0,0 across the board for my compression -- sounds like bent valves to me -- what do you guys think?

re do the head, new oil pump, water pump, and timing belt in order it sounds liek
 
the cars timing was probaly off alot and you bent some valves.. and just to make sure i would do a leak down test to make sure you're rings arent worn out as well. dsmgraveyard has 2G heads new and used that you could slap on to get her running again

and yes absolutely change the water and oil pumps, and timing belt
